Wireless Network

Wireless connection to the College Network is now available through much of the College; there are some rooms, however, where the connection is rather poor; on the other hand the Library, Bar and Hall are all covered.

Two wireless connections are available; one (with a name that begins 'SC-WiFi') is simple to access, but, because it is insecure, is restricted in scope. It also requires you to connect with a Raven password, and to keep open a particular web page, otherwise the connection will be closed. The other connection is a more secure wireless network, named eduroam - see eduroam.html. Note that in College Hall the connection uses the University Computing Service's Lapwing network, and is named 'Lapwing'

The same conditions of use apply to wireless as to wired network; you will have to register, and agree to pay the connection fee even if you only use the wireless network in, say, the Library.

Students who are not living in College accommodation who would like to make only occasional, only wireless, use of our network may be able to benefit from a reduced rate for such a connection. Contact the IT Office , tel (3)35850 if you believe that you come into this category.
